"Service Bulletin - Burning oil smell from under hood and/or MIL comes on with DTC P2096 and/or P2270 due to possible porosity in the cylinder head cover bolt hole may cause oil to weep out onto Bank 1 (Rear Cylinder Head) catalytic converter and oxygen sensor. Some cases will turn on the MIL, setting DTC P2096 and/or P2270."

Is there a fix? Manufacturer service bulletins
The manufacturer has issued service bulletins covering engine on this vehicle — documented repair instructions, service campaigns, or warranty extensions sent to dealers. A TSB isn't a recall (it's not a free safety remedy), but it's the manufacturer acknowledging the issue and how to fix it.
